Taking part in physical activity is a brilliant way for you to improve your self-esteem, escape the demands of daily life, and increase your fitness levels. However, getting involved with a group activity comes with even more benefits. Not only are you getting fit and healthy, but you are also spending time with like-minded individuals in a positive environment that is all about support and teamwork. From soccer to surfing, there is no activity where working with others puts you at a disadvantage. That is why you should embrace any opportunity to club together with your fellow enthusiasts. Once you have done this, you will need to focus your efforts on boosting the profile of your team. Below are five tips that will help you to do this.

Create your own merchandise

The first step is to create your own team merchandise. This is a fantastic opportunity for you to bring in some extra money that can go towards specialist training equipment and new uniforms. It is also a brilliant way for you to unify your followers and boost team morale. The first step is to develop your logo, establish your colors, and select a mascot, as this will come in handy if you would like to create t-shirts, flags, banners, scarves, and even foam fingers. You should also look out for merchandise that is specific to your chosen sport. For instance, if you are in charge of a baseball team, you should invest in baseball trading pins. There is no better way for you to attract collectors to your games and create a buzz around your sporting events.

Get on social media

In this digital age, it is important that you and your team are engaging with social media. Social media channelsare an incredible opportunity for you to spread news of your achievements outside of your local area. It is also a fast-paced and interactive way for you to talk to your following. That is why you should set up an Instagram account, Twitter account, and Facebook page. Then, you should get to work creating content that is sure to pique the interest of your online audience. You could even get your teammates involved in the process. Perhaps they could write a blog post on how thesport has changed their life. Maybe they could conduct an interview with one of their lifelongheroes. Alternatively, you could take it in turns to ask willing fans to capture as many actionshots as possible. Whatever you decide, just make sure that there is someone responsiblein charge of monitoring this online content. Failing to take this safety measure could result in an embarrassing blunder or a public relations disaster.

Set up a YouTube channel

Another great online platform to explore is YouTube, as it is the perfect site for any sports teams that spend a lot of time training and taking part in competitions. Instead of leaving your followers out of the loop, you can upload videos of this process. Of course, you don’t want to play into the hands of your competitors by sharing too much, but putting out short and simple clips is a fantastic way for you to attract attention and achieve sponsorships. If you are working with young people, this footage could also act as evidence when they are trying to enter a scholarship program. If you decide to push forward with this option, you will need to invest in high-quality equipment that will prevent your videos from being grainy and shaky. You should also look out for equipment that will allow you to produce creative content. For instance, if you lead a group of bungee jumpers or extreme rock climbers, you should look into camera headsets. Go-Pros are also ideal for water sports. Instead of handling a heavy camera, you can capture incredible footage, without the use of your hands.

Lend a helping hand

Whether you decide to create social media accounts, a YouTube channel or both, you should endeavor to upload good news stories onto these platforms. This is an excellent way for you to surround your team with positive publicity. It is also a great way for you to gain the support of your local community and this is why you should look out for any opportunities to lend a helping hand. You should also adopt a proactive approach, instead of waiting to be asked. Why not reach out to your local council and find out if there are any areas of land that you could transform into a play area, a meditation garden, or a dog park? Not only is this the ideal chance for you to bring your team members closer together, but it is also a great way to leave your mark on the neighborhood. Just remember to put up plenty of signs to make it clear who was involved in the project. Another option is to make the most of your collective fitness levels and take part in a sponsored run, climb, or cycle. Or, if you are a group of experts, you could offer other people the chance to carry out a sporting activity for charity. You could provide them with all of the essential equipment, offer them a couple of training sessions, and host the big day.

Throw an end of season celebration

Finally, you should get to work throwing an end of season celebration for your team. A celebration is a perfect opportunity for you to acknowledge all that you have achieved throughout the year. It is also a great chance for you to increase interest in your organization, as you can invite along family, friends, and members of the local community. Even if your team carries out their activities all year round, you should still set up an annual celebration where everyone comes together to reflect. What better occasion for you to hand out awards, offer a word of thanks to your sponsors, and talk about your plans for the future?
